As I said, it is still in the test phase. It was on a limited rollout targeted to areas that are experiencing the most problems. Posts here and at the other site are being monitored. Should users find the update successful, it will be spooled out to the rest of the users.

This seems to be a big update in file size - it took over 20 minutes to download - and now it is copying to the firmware and that is taking longer than usual as well (several minutes so far)... ah finally the reboot... allow up to 30 minutes in total...
This update [L6.15] have usual size ~16 MB, but spooling at slow speed - 100 Kbps; max speed is 500 Kbps for other more important SW.

I never get good results with OTA when the signal is 100. I use an attenuator to bring that down to 80 something and things look good.
